Future Goals
Committed to strengthening the fabric of community through programs and services that promote youth development, healthy living, and social responsibility, the YMCA of Central Massachusetts will remain focused on enhancing the well-being of children and families throughout the region by:
1. Strengthening, cultivating, engaging and retaining the next generation of leaders in staff, governance and volunteers to support a cause-driven organization;
2. Providing a nurturing and empowering environment for young people by offering child care, leadership development, and academic support services that foster real-world skills.
3. Utilizing evidence-based health programs to advance health seekers’ goals with an emphasis on supporting vulnerable populations;
4. Partnering with over 100 local organizations to deliver innovative initiatives to improve community health;
5. Embracing a network of individuals united in their commitment to helping others lead better lives, with volunteer engagement continuing to be a cornerstone of our mission.
